MySQL快速指南:如何删除基本表

资源类型:klfang.com 2025-07-23 19:57

mysql删除基本表简介:



MySQL中的基本表删除操作:重要性与实施指南 在数据库管理中,删除操作是一个需要谨慎处理的重要环节

    特别是在使用MySQL这样的关系型数据库时,对基本表的删除不仅影响数据的完整性,还可能对整个系统的稳定性和安全性产生深远影响

    本文将深入探讨MySQL中删除基本表的操作,分析其重要性,并提供实施指南,以帮助数据库管理员和开发者更加安全、有效地执行这一任务

     一、删除基本表的重要性 1.数据维护与优化:随着系统的长期运行,数据库中可能会积累大量不再需要或过时的数据表

    这些无用的数据表不仅占用宝贵的存储空间,还可能影响数据库的性能

    定期清理这些不再使用的数据表,可以释放存储空间,提高数据库的查询效率

     2.数据安全管理:某些包含敏感信息的数据表,在数据使用完毕后需要及时删除,以防止数据泄露或被非法访问

    通过删除这些表,可以降低数据被滥用的风险,保护用户的隐私

     3.系统升级与迁移:在进行系统升级或迁移时,可能需要删除旧的数据表,以适应新的数据结构或存储需求

    删除操作在这一过程中是不可或缺的

     二、删除基本表的步骤与注意事项 在MySQL中删除基本表是一个简单但危险的操作

    一旦执行,表中的所有数据和结构都将被永久删除

    因此,在执行删除操作前,必须严格遵守以下步骤和注意事项: 1.备份数据:在删除任何表之前,首先要确保已经对数据进行了完整备份

    这是防止数据丢失的最基本措施

    一旦删除操作发生错误,或者后续发现删除的数据仍然需要,可以通过备份文件进行恢复

     2.确认删除的必要性:在删除表之前,要仔细评估删除的必要性

    确认该表是否真的不再需要,或者是否已经完成了其历史使命

    这需要与项目团队、数据管理员和其他相关人员进行充分沟通

     3.检查依赖关系:在删除表之前,要检查该表是否与其他表存在外键约束或其他依赖关系

    如果存在依赖关系,直接删除可能会导致数据不一致或其他未预期的问题

    需要先解除这些依赖关系,或者进行适当的数据迁移

     4.执行删除操作:在确认以上步骤无误后,可以执行删除操作

    在MySQL中,删除基本表的SQL语句非常简单,即`DROP TABLE 表名;`

    执行此语句后,指定的表及其所有数据将被永久删除

     5.验证删除结果:删除表后,要通过查询数据库或使用数据库管理工具来确认表已被成功删除

    同时,也要检查其他相关表或系统功能是否受到影响

     6.更新文档和记录:删除表后,要及时更新相关的数据库设计文档和操作记录

    这是为了保持文档的准确性,并为未来的数据库维护提供参考

     三、避免误删除的策略 为了防止误删除或不当删除,可以采取以下策略: 1.建立严格的权限管理:确保只有经过授权的用户才能执行删除操作

    通过为不同的用户或角色分配不同的权限级别,可以有效防止未经授权的删除行为

     2.使用事务处理:在执行删除操作前,可以开启一个事务

    这样,如果在删除过程中发现任何问题或错误,可以立即回滚事务,恢复到删除之前的状态

     3.定期审查与审计:定期对数据库的删除操作进行审查和审计,确保所有删除行为都是合法和合规的

    这也有助于及时发现并纠正任何不当的删除行为

     四、总结 在MySQL中删除基本表是一个需要高度谨慎的操作

    通过遵循本文提到的步骤和注意事项,以及采取有效的避免误删除的策略,可以确保这一操作的安全性和有效性

    同时,数据库管理员和开发者也应该保持对数据库结构的持续关注和优化,以确保系统的稳定性和性能

    在删除数据表时,务必牢记数据的重要性和不可逆性,谨慎行事,以防不必要的数据丢失或系统问题

    

阅读全文
上一篇:初体验:第一次使用MySQL全攻略

最新收录:

  • 揭秘:如何安全处理MySQL密码问题
  • 初体验:第一次使用MySQL全攻略
  • MySQL安装失败,卸载困境:解决方案来了!
  • CentOS7卸载MySQL数据库教程
  • MySQL技巧:轻松获取上一条保存数据的ID
  • MySQL数据导入命令实操指南
  • 一键获取MySQL安装包:详细指南助你轻松找到并安装MySQL
  • MySQL Front智能提示:高效编程,轻松上手
  • MySQL数据可视化绘图技巧
  • MySQL视图能否进行JOIN操作?
  • “MySQL数据报表生成攻略:轻松掌握数据库报表制作技巧”
  • MySQL源码调试入门教程解析
  • 首页 | mysql删除基本表:MySQL快速指南:如何删除基本表